About Nottingham
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 5 °C, with humidity levels of about 82%.
Nottingham is home of the academic institute University of Nottingham. The biggest sports facility in Nottingham is City Ground,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Queen's Medical Centre.
Nature lovers can unwind at Wollaton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Nottingham Castle Museum, which showcases Nottingham’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Nottingham Central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from East Midlands Airport by Airport Shuttle, Taxi and Bus.
There are several ways to get around Nottingham with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us, Tram and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Victoria Bus Station, Nottingham Station and Nottingham Station.
In Nottingham,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Contactless Card, Cash and Mobile Payment.
About Edinburgh
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 78%. Winters bring an average temperature of 5 °C, with humidity levels of about 81%.
Edinburgh is home of the academic institute University of Edinburgh. The biggest sports facility in Edinburgh is Murrayfield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Royal Infirmary of Edinburgh.
Nature lovers can unwind at Holyrood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the National Museum of Scotland, which showcases Edinburgh’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it National Library of Scotland for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Edinburgh Airport by Airport bus, Taxi and Train.
There are several ways to get around Edinburgh with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us, Train and Tram.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Edinburgh Bus Station, Edinburgh Waverley and Edinburgh Gateway.
In Edinburgh,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Contactless card, Cash and Transport for Edinburgh Card.
